Following a large reform of the Belgian football league system at the end of the 2015–16 season, the play-offs were no longer held.
Four teams normally played these play-offs, with the winner being promoted to (or avoiding relegation from) the Belgian Pro League.
Exceptions to these rules were numerous, as no team is allowed to play in the first division without a professional license.
The play-offs were a double round robin tournament with 6 matchdays, spaced over 19 days.
